North Miami Beach, FL vs Pompano Beach, FL
North Miami Beach, FL and Pompano Beach, FL have a very similar cost of living, with only a 0.6% difference in their overall index. North Miami Beach scores 115 while Pompano Beach scores 115 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
On the housing front, median rent in North Miami Beach is $1,626/month compared to $1,636/month in Pompano Beach — a 1%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: North Miami Beach is more affordable at $317,800 median vs $321,900.
Median household income in North Miami Beach is $57,633 compared to $63,832 in Pompano Beach (-9.7%). While Pompano Beach is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of North Miami Beach spend roughly 33.9% of their income on rent, more than the 30.8% in Pompano Beach. The Pompano Beach ratio exceeds the commonly recommended 30% threshold, which can put pressure on household budgets.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(77.3°F vs 77.2°F). North Miami Beach receives more rainfall at 62" per year compared to 55.6" in Pompano Beach.
